About agriculture in Whitburn

Whitburn is situated in West Lothian, Scotland, positioned conveniently between the major cities of Edinburgh and Glasgow. The surrounding landscape is characterized by the rolling hills of the Scottish Central Belt, offering a mix of post-industrial land and expansive green spaces. The rural areas around the town feature a blend of woodland and open fields, typical of the lowland regions of the country.

Agriculture in the vicinity of Whitburn is predominantly focused on mixed farming. The fertile but often damp soil supports the cultivation of hardy crops like barley and oats, primarily used for animal feed. Livestock farming is significant, with many farms specializing in beef cattle and sheep grazing on the lush pastures. There are also smaller-scale horticultural operations that benefit from the proximity to urban markets.
